
Introduction to Chickpea Flour Pancakes
Looking for a delicious and nutritious breakfast option? Chickpea flour pancakes might be just what you need! These pancakes, made from ground chickpeas, are not only simple to prepare but also full of flavor and health benefits.
Chickpea flour, commonly known as besan or gram flour, is a key ingredient in many traditional dishes, especially in Indian cuisine. This versatile flour is gaining traction globally, particularly among those who embrace plant-based diets.
Nutritionally, chickpeas are impressive. They offer a wealth of protein, d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als, making them a fantastic addition to your meals. Opting for chickpea flour pancakes means choosing a wholesome breakfast that can keep you energized throughout the day.

Why Choose Chickpea Flour?
High Protein Content and Dietary Fiber
One of the remarkable aspects of chickpea flour is its protein content. Each serving provides a substantial amount of protein, essential for muscle maintenance and repair. Additionally, the fiber in chickpea flour promotes digestive health and helps you feel fuller for longer.
Gluten-Free Option for Those with Dietary Restrictions
Chickpea flour is an excellent gluten-free alternative for those with gluten sensitivities or celiac disease. You can enjoy these pancakes without the worry of gluten-related issues, making them a safe and tasty choice for many.
Rich in Vitamins and Minerals
Chickpeas are loaded with essential vitamins and minerals, such as folate, iron, magnesium, and various B vitamins. Including chickpea flour in your diet boosts the nutritional quality of your meals and supports overall health.
Ingredients for Chickpea Flour Pancakes
To create tasty chickpea flour pancakes, gather the following main ingredients:
- 1 cup chickpea flour
- 1 cup water (adjust based on desired thickness)
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on turmeric (optional, for enhanced flavor and color)
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per (or to taste)
Optional Ingredients
You can customize your pancakes by adding:
- Chopped vegetables (like spinach, bell peppers, or onions)
- Fresh herbs (such as cilantro, parsley, or chives)
- Extra spices (like cumin or paprika for more flavor)
Recommended Cooking Tools
- Mixing bowl: For combining the ingredients.
- Whisk: To achieve a smooth batter.
- Skillet or frying pan: For cooking the pancakes.
- Spatula: For flipping the pancakes.
Step-by-Step Recipe Guide
Preparing the Batter
- In a mixing bowl, combine 1 cup of chickpea flour, 1 cup of water, 1/2 teaspoon of salt, 1/2 teaspoon of turmeric, and 1/4 teaspoon of black pepper.
- Whisk the mixture until it becomes smooth and lump-free. The batter should be pourable but thick enough to maintain its shape.
Adding Vegetables and Herbs
- For added flavor, consider mixing in your choice of chopped vegetables and herbs. Spinach and cilantro pair especially well with the nutty taste of chickpea flour.
Cooking Instructions
- He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at and lightly grease it with a small amount of oil.
- Once the skillet is hot, pour a ladleful of batter onto it. Use the back of the ladle to spread it into a round shape.
- Cook for about 3-4 minutes, or until the edges begin to lift and the bottom turns a golden brown.
- Carefully flip the pancake using a spatula and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es on the other side.

Tips for Perfect Chickpea Flour Pancakes
Consistency of the Batter
Getting the right consistency for your batter is vital. If it seems too thick, add a bit more water; if too thin, mix in a little more chickpea flour. Aim for a batter that is pourable yet sturdy.
Adjusting Spices for Flavor Preferences
Feel free to modify the spices to suit your taste. If you like a bit of heat, consider adding cayenne or chili powder. Experimenting with various herbs and spices can yield delightful flavor combinations!
Cooking Tips to Prevent Sticking
To keep pancakes from sticking to the skillet, ensure the pan is sufficiently heated and well-oiled. Non-stick pans are ideal, but if using a regular skillet, allow it to heat thoroughly before adding the batter.
Serving Suggestions and Variations
Recommended Toppings
Chickpea flour pancakes are incredibly versatile and can be topped with a variety of delicious options:
- Sliced avocado for creaminess.
- Vegan yogurt for a tangy touch.
- Fresh herbs for an extra burst of flavor.
Variations
Feel free to try different variations:
- Savory pancakes: Enhance the batter with spices and vegetables for a hearty dish.
- Sweet pancakes: Add fruits or a drizzle of maple syrup for a delightful twist.
Meal Pairing Ideas
Serve your chickpea flour pancakes with fresh fruit, smoothies, or a light salad for a well-rounded breakfast or brunch.
